Student engagement in high school tutoring is crucial for effective learning, yet many students find traditional methods uninspiring. To address this, a new adaptive tutoring system was created using large language models (LLMs) that tailor interactions based on individual student needs and preferences.
The system employs natural language processing to generate personalized prompts and feedback, enhancing the learning experience. A study was conducted to evaluate its effectiveness, revealing a significant increase in student engagement metrics, with a reported 30% improvement in session participation.
Additionally, student satisfaction ratings rose by 25%, indicating a positive reception of the adaptive approach. These findings suggest that integrating LLMs into educational settings can foster a more engaging and responsive learning environment, potentially transforming traditional tutoring methods.
